What's the way to calculate the following integral $$\int_0^{\infty}\frac{\cos x-e^{-x}}{x}\,dx?$$ The answer is zero. I tried to split into two integrals $\int_0^{\infty}\frac{1-\cos x}{x}\,dx$ and $\int_0^{\infty}\frac{1-e^{-x}}{x}\,dx$ but they both don't exist. Integration by parts failed for the same reason: integral and one of the limits don't exist.
